How to Save Money on Toilet Paper

Hubs smirks a little every time I buy toilet paper.

Maybe it’s because our bath tissue gets delivered by the UPS man. And of course there’s the fact that it comes in a HUGE box. The first time it was delivered, Hubs and the kids were all excited about what kind of awesomeness was in the big box. Imagine their delight disgust when it turned out to be nothing but TP. **muah ha ha ha**

But I was overjoyed!! Not only have I found that ordering our toilet paper from Amazon is the least expensive way to go, but I only have to bother with it once every three months or so.

I just ordered today. Let me show you how I do it.

::First I search for bath tissue in Health & Personal Care on Amazon.

::Then I narrow down the search to only those brands of bath tissue we like to use. In this case, it’s Cottonelle, Quilted Northern or Charmin. You can’t see it on the image below, but I also scroll down a bit and click the “subscribe & save” category.

amazon-tp-search::Then I peruse the search page for the least expensive deal with a Subscribe & Save option. Not only does this save  a little extra money but 2-day shipping is always free with Subscribe & Save.

::I also check the page to see if there are any available coupons to clip.

If you choose not to continue with Subscribe & Save deliveries, just login to your Amazon account and click on “Your Subscribe & Save Items”. You can cancel anytime after your delivery ships.

The cool thing is that Subscribe & Save applies to lots of other products besides toilet paper (including food and diapers). Just look for prices lower than what you would normally pay at the store and take advantage of this easy way to save without clipping coupons.
